Crescent Township, Pennsylvania, offers a variety of outdoor activities and family-friendly experiences that cater to all ages. One of the highlights is the scenic nature trails at Crescent Township Park, where families can enjoy leisurely walks or bike rides. The park features playgrounds for younger children, providing a perfect spot for them to play and explore while parents relax nearby.
For those who appreciate water activities, the nearby Ohio River is a fantastic destination. Families can enjoy picnicking along the riverbanks or take a peaceful stroll on the walking paths that offer beautiful views of the water. Birdwatching is also popular here, as the river is home to various species of birds throughout the year.
A short drive of about 30 minutes will take you to the beautiful Raccoon Creek State Park. This expansive park features hiking trails, fishing spots, and picnic areas. The park’s diverse ecosystems provide excellent opportunities for nature study, and the serene environment makes it a great place for family outings.
If you’re looking for a place to enjoy some seasonal activities, consider visiting the local farms in the region during harvest time. Many farms offer pick-your-own experiences, where families can gather fruits and vegetables together, making for a fun and educational day out.
When the weather is less than ideal, the nearby Moon Township offers the Moon Park, which includes indoor facilities and sports fields. This park provides a place for children to engage in physical activities, even during rainy days.
Families can also explore the nearby town of Sewickley, about a 15-minute drive away. Sewickley features charming shops and a lovely walking area along the bank of the Ohio River. The town’s community parks are perfect for enjoying a leisurely afternoon outdoors.
For those interested in a longer drive, approximately 45 minutes away is the historic town of Beaver. Here, visitors can explore the Beaver River and enjoy its scenic views while learning about the area’s rich history. The local parks along the river offer peaceful spots for picnics and relaxation.
